Default Re: Bug with HEAT rounds?

HEAT rounds won't doo much against infantry - but still much more than AP shots After all, they contain quite a big charge that goes "bang" - so are and were usedoften against soft targets in situations HEAT was only available type of explosive ammo - be it with modern 120mm smoothbore or with Panzerfaust. M72 LAW was used to a great extent in Vietnam against trenches etc., often fired in volleys just prior the assault. RPG-7 was used extensively in A-stan, and modern HEAT rounds even do have sometimes enhanced fragmentation (M830A1) to improve this effect.
In-game, HEAT against infantry was introduced in the last version and is a great addition IMHO. Rules are IIRC (too lazy to check manual ATM) that unit will fire HEAT at inf if weapon does have HE kill, no HE ammo and more than 4 HEAT ammo left. The 4 EAT are kept in reserve "in case".
